Ststephenselca.com's availability has been checked 0 times over the past 0 days, starting from December 23, 2024. As of December 23, 2024, ststephenselca.com was unreachable or having problems, according to all assessments conducted. No downtime incidents were noted for ststephenselca.com in inspections performed as of December 23, 2024. Based on all replies received as of December 23, 2024, there have been no errors found in any responses. Ststephenselca.com replied in 0 seconds on December 23, 2024, differing from its 0.000 seconds average response time.